k*****u 发帖数: 1688 | 1 大家好,在下有一个问题想请教大家,请多多指教:
我们现在用python开发了一个模型给别人用,直接给code对方用起来会很复杂,也不方
便。现在想了这么两个办法来做:
1:做成gui。对方按照给定的格式准备好数据(比如excel)文件,然后点击gui按钮上
传数据。最后pop out结果(也是excel或者csv)。这样他们用起来方便。打算用
tkinter实现这样的功能。请问这样可行么?或者能否请大家介绍一些tkinter的实例参
考一下?
2:做成online的。也就是把gui换成了网页。对方直接从我们的网页上传数据,算完以
后,再弹出结果给他们。这样的有没有什么参考的网页?
多谢帮忙。 |
n******7 发帖数: 12463 | 2 我以前老板电脑水平不好
给他干活的就做了个gui
点点鼠标就好 |
c*********e 发帖数: 16335 | 3 作个online的。不过,要考虑:
1。 文件size limit.别上载10g的文件。
2。 如果文件数据不对,出错了怎么处理?要显示在网页上还是发个email给对方?
3。exception handling.比如对方上载的不是excel,csv文件,是个jpg文件,你怎么显
示错误信息?
4。考虑用multi-threading.比如文件里有40000行数据,用multi-threading回更
快。
【在 k*****u 的大作中提到】 : 大家好,在下有一个问题想请教大家,请多多指教: : 我们现在用python开发了一个模型给别人用,直接给code对方用起来会很复杂,也不方 : 便。现在想了这么两个办法来做: : 1:做成gui。对方按照给定的格式准备好数据(比如excel)文件,然后点击gui按钮上 : 传数据。最后pop out结果(也是excel或者csv)。这样他们用起来方便。打算用 : tkinter实现这样的功能。请问这样可行么?或者能否请大家介绍一些tkinter的实例参 : 考一下? : 2:做成online的。也就是把gui换成了网页。对方直接从我们的网页上传数据,算完以 : 后,再弹出结果给他们。这样的有没有什么参考的网页? : 多谢帮忙。
|
k*****u 发帖数: 1688 | 4 多谢多谢
能不能指导一下,如果做online的,用什么工具(哪个package好)?
我现在想到的是:
1:有个输入框,让对方upload excel文件
2:读入这个文件,然后运行我们的程序
这其中可能有一些 checkbox 来选择不同的参数或者模型
3:最后的输出也是excel file,弹出让对方下载
别的会慢慢加上。
有没有什么框架或者实例介绍一下?
多谢各位帮忙
【在 c*********e 的大作中提到】 : 作个online的。不过,要考虑: : 1。 文件size limit.别上载10g的文件。 : 2。 如果文件数据不对,出错了怎么处理?要显示在网页上还是发个email给对方? : 3。exception handling.比如对方上载的不是excel,csv文件,是个jpg文件,你怎么显 : 示错误信息? : 4。考虑用multi-threading.比如文件里有40000行数据,用multi-threading回更 : 快。
|
l******n 发帖数: 9344 | 5 用r做前端然后call python
【在 k*****u 的大作中提到】 : 多谢多谢 : 能不能指导一下,如果做online的,用什么工具(哪个package好)? : 我现在想到的是: : 1:有个输入框,让对方upload excel文件 : 2:读入这个文件,然后运行我们的程序 : 这其中可能有一些 checkbox 来选择不同的参数或者模型 : 3:最后的输出也是excel file,弹出让对方下载 : 别的会慢慢加上。 : 有没有什么框架或者实例介绍一下? : 多谢各位帮忙
|
f*******t 发帖数: 7549 | |
a****e 发帖数: 9589 | 7 PHP
【在 k*****u 的大作中提到】 : 多谢多谢 : 能不能指导一下,如果做online的,用什么工具(哪个package好)? : 我现在想到的是: : 1:有个输入框,让对方upload excel文件 : 2:读入这个文件,然后运行我们的程序 : 这其中可能有一些 checkbox 来选择不同的参数或者模型 : 3:最后的输出也是excel file,弹出让对方下载 : 别的会慢慢加上。 : 有没有什么框架或者实例介绍一下? : 多谢各位帮忙
|
k*****u 发帖数: 1688 | 8 谢谢 :(
现在没时间在学php 只想赶快弄个东西出来先
【在 a****e 的大作中提到】 : PHP
|
k*****u 发帖数: 1688 | 9 谢谢
R使用rstudio server么?
以前在三藩的时候看过shiny的作者演示过,是不是用这个挺不错的?
还是什么package?
有没有实例能介绍一下看看
谢谢帮忙
【在 f*******t 的大作中提到】 : 好像R+ipython就是做这种活的
|
f*******t 发帖数: 7549 | 10 以前帮人setup运行环境,装了R和ipython notebook,可以得到一个web UI。上传文件
后可以用R进行分析,具体情况不太了解,没直接用过。
【在 k*****u 的大作中提到】 : 谢谢 : R使用rstudio server么? : 以前在三藩的时候看过shiny的作者演示过,是不是用这个挺不错的? : 还是什么package? : 有没有实例能介绍一下看看 : 谢谢帮忙
|
c*********e 发帖数: 16335 | 11 最好是先存到数据库了再处理数据,以防上传中间internet断掉,或者断电等意外事故。
【在 k*****u 的大作中提到】 : 大家好,在下有一个问题想请教大家,请多多指教: : 我们现在用python开发了一个模型给别人用,直接给code对方用起来会很复杂,也不方 : 便。现在想了这么两个办法来做: : 1:做成gui。对方按照给定的格式准备好数据(比如excel)文件,然后点击gui按钮上 : 传数据。最后pop out结果(也是excel或者csv)。这样他们用起来方便。打算用 : tkinter实现这样的功能。请问这样可行么?或者能否请大家介绍一些tkinter的实例参 : 考一下? : 2:做成online的。也就是把gui换成了网页。对方直接从我们的网页上传数据,算完以 : 后,再弹出结果给他们。这样的有没有什么参考的网页? : 多谢帮忙。
|
g**********l 发帖数: 214 | 12 are you looking for a server solution or not? you need to think about
- do you have a server?
- what environment? (some company has restriction on what kind of server/vm
they can provision). this may limit some of your options.
suppose your company can give you a linux vm to run your server application,
would you be able to run your web services given the limitation of the
network/access/provision limitation? (this you may want to consider when you
choose a solution) |